10. Set the Starting Bid Price
You need to enter the price at which the auction starts. Bidding always begins at an amount higher than you specify. The Starting Bid Price cannot equal zero.
11. Enter the Bid Increment
The Bid Increment is the minimum value by which the bid increases and is set by the seller. We suggest that the Bid Increment value be kept to round figures. For example, Rs. 50 or Rs.100 would be a nice Bid Increment.
12. Fix the Reserve Price
The reserve price is the lowest price the seller is willing to accept for the product he's selling. This amount is set by the seller before the auction starts and is never disclosed to the bidders.
